In a notable move to enhance its delivery efficiency, UPS has announced a strategic agreement aimed at retrofitting its package delivery vehicles for regions experiencing the hottest climate. This initiative comes as the company seeks to not only meet the demands of a growing e-commerce sector but also to ensure the comfort and safety of its drivers. With the Teamsters union involved, this development signals a collaborative effort to prioritize both operational effectiveness and employee welfare.
The newly established Letter of Agreement stipulates that UPS will expedite the conversion of its fleet to include air-conditioned vehicles in areas where high temperatures can become a significant challenge. This enhancement is particularly crucial as summer temperatures rise, impacting not just delivery times but also the health of drivers who spend long hours on the road. By prioritizing air conditioning retrofits, UPS is not only improving working conditions but also potentially increasing productivity.
